交换机的数据平面、控制平面、管理平面分离设计_冒险岛达人_新浪博客
交换机数据平面
    交换机的基本任务是处理和转发交换机各不同端口上各种类型的数据,对于数据处理过程中各种具体的处理转发过程,例如L2/L3/ACL/QOS/组播/安全防护等各功能的具体执行过程,都属于交换机数据平面的任务范畴。
    交换机的数据平面在交换机的各种平面任务当中需要占用决大部分的资源,也直接地对交换机的性能表现起决定作用,各个厂家都通过各种技术手段和芯片技术努力地提高交换机数据平面的处理性能。
交换机控制平面
    交换机的控制平面用于控制和管理所有网络协议的运行,例如生成树协议、VLAN协议、ARP协议、各种路由协议和组播协议等等的管理和控制。交换机控制平面通过网络协议提供给交换机对整个网络环境中网络设备、连接链路和交互协议的准确了解,并在网络状况发生改变时做出及时的调整以维护网络的正常运行。控制平面提供了数据平面数据处理转发前所必须的各种网络信息和转发查询表项。
    交换机的控制平面并不占用过多的主机资源,但在正常状况下依然是交换机CPU资源的主要占用平面,因此除了优化交换机对于控制平面的调度流程和效率,一般还可以通过提供多CPU或提高CPU的处理性能来提高交换机的控制平面性能。
交换机管理平面
    交换机的管理平面是提供给网络管理人员使用TELNET、WEB、SSH、SNMP、RMON等方式来管理设备,并支持、理解和执行管理人员对于网络设备各种网络协议的设置命令。管理平面提供了控制平面正常运行的前提,管理平面必须预先设置好控制平面中各种协议的相关参数,并支持在必要时刻对控制平面的运行进行干预。
    交换机的管理平面所需的交换机资源最少,目前都通过交换机CPU实现。
郑重声明:资讯 【交换机的数据平面、控制平面、管理平面分离设计_冒险岛达人_新浪博客】由 发布,版权归原作者及其所在单位,其原创性以及文中陈述文字和内容未经(企业库qiyeku.com)证实,请读者仅作参考,并请自行核实相关内容。若本文有侵犯到您的版权, 请你提供相关证明及申请并与我们联系(qiyeku # qq.com)或【在线投诉】,我们审核后将会尽快处理。
—— 相关资讯 ——